Why Smart Lighting Matters for Streamers
Smart lighting systems are essential for streamers aiming to deliver high-quality content. Proper lighting enhances video clarity, reduces shadows, and sets the mood. Additionally, smart lights offer dynamic color adjustments and automation, allowing streamers to synchronize lighting effects with their content or gameplay, creating a more immersive experience for viewers.
Top Features to Consider in 2026
- Color Customization: Ability to choose millions of colors for perfect ambiance.
- Voice Control: Integration with voice ass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ant.
- Automation: Scheduling and scene setting for different streaming phases.
- App Control: User-friendly mobile apps for easy adjustments.
- Sync with Content: Lights that react to music, game sounds, or alerts.

Setting Up Your Smart Lighting System
Installing a smart lighting system is straightforward. Most systems connect via Wi-Fi or Bluetooth and come with detailed instructions. Position lights to illuminate your background and face evenly. Use the accompanying app to customize colors, brightness, and automation schedules for optimal streaming conditions.
Tips for Maximizing Your Lighting Setup
- Test different color schemes to find what best suits your content and personality.
- Sync lighting effects with your gameplay or music for added engagement.
- Use automation to switch scenes during different streaming segments.
- Ensure lights are positioned to avoid glare or shadows on your face.
- Regularly update firmware and app software for new features and stability.
